door speakers not working?

My door speakers aren't working; anyone have suggestions? Thanks!

I didn't think mine were working at all either until I asked about them. Turns out they are just small subs. I don't have the rear speakers, just the fronts and sides, and the sides are just for lows. Maybe this is what you have?

Yeah, as stupid as it sounds, feel the door with your stereo turned up to make sure they're not working After that, normal speaker diagnostics commence: Check to see if you're getting a signal at the plug, check the resistance (in Ohms) of the speaker to make sure it isn't blown, etc.

Just went through upgarding all speakers in my Box.

The original door speakers are meant to be for midrange only so you wont get any real sound from them.

Cheack and make sure the fader is set to 0 and that the bass level is set above 0. If you have any vibration or bass sound when turned up then they are working as they were designed.
